Using NationBuilder to engage supporters in creating change

I've been using NationBuilder since 2013 and working with political campaigns, NGOs, unions, and ethical businesses. I came to NationBuilder as an organiser and have been very impressed with how it facilitates organisers to identify and develop leaders while building relationships with supporters. I've also been working as an architect to help clients realise their vision for the website that they want.
